Barack Obama utilized the Georgia 300 twice; first in April 2008 for a trip between Philadelphia and Harrisburg, Pa; and secondly before his 2009 inauguration on a whistle stop to Washington DC, along a similar route to that used by Abraham Lincoln. The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) prevented private planes, news helicopters, balloonists and others from flying anywhere near the airspace above the train route. These rolling NOTAM flight restrictions prevented general aviation from flying near stations and above the linear route of sections of the Northeast Corridor railroad line "for Special Security Reasons".So... The train used consisted of two Amtrak GE Genesis locomotives, numbers 44 and 120, several Amfleet coaches and cafes, and the Georgia 300 at the rear.

44 120 signifies 44th POTUS on January 20. Electric engines were either 6XX (Hippos) or 9XX (Toasters) and would not have satisfied that symbolism someone at (then) 60 Mass wanted. There was also the security concern of some bad guy cutting the juice and here come the Bazookas.
Even Georgia 300 has significance. Lest we forget, battleground state where a serious challenge to the Election was raised (the car should have been named Georgia 16 - 16 Electoral Votes).
